Coralum Ore and Chromite are two of the most tedious materials to gather in Palworld 1.0. Coralum Ore means fishing deep-sea supply drops with a magnet and rod, and Chromite means sweeping certain islands with a Metal Detector. The 1.0 update ends both grinds.

The Ancient Material Synthesizer is a level 78 base structure that produces any wood or ore on demand. Assign one mining Pal, pick a recipe, and it turns out Coralum Ore, Chromite, or whatever you are short on. Here is how to unlock it, what it costs, and how to run it, from a walkthrough by HeRo Survival Guides.

What the Ancient Material Synthesizer does#

The Ancient Material Synthesizer is a Production structure that, in the game's own words, uses the power of the World Tree to produce all kinds of wood and ore. You interact with it, open the Recipe List, and choose a single material to run. The station then produces that material continuously while a Pal is assigned.

Its recipe list covers the full spread of gathering materials, from wood and stone all the way up to the rare ores you normally hunt across the map. Coralum Ore and Chromite are both on the menu, which is what makes this the strongest endgame ore setup in the game.

Unlock it and the build cost#

The station unlocks at level 78 in the Technology tree, under Ancient Technology. It is an endgame build, and the materials match:

RequirementsLevel 78+

Paloxite Ingot and Ancient Civilization Core are both late-game materials, so plan to build this once you are already deep into the endgame. This is a permanent base upgrade that pays for itself the first time you would otherwise farm ore by hand.

Set up the ore farm#

Setup takes under a minute once the station is placed. Only one Pal can work it, so put your strongest miner on the job.

  1. 1Build the Ancient Material Synthesizer at your base

    Place it like any other production structure once it is unlocked.

  2. 2Interact and open the Recipe List

    Use the select-recipe prompt to see every available material.

  3. 3Pick Coralum Ore or Chromite

    Every wood and ore recipe is selectable, so choose whatever you are short on.

  4. 4Assign one mining Pal

    The station takes a single worker, so use your highest Mining Pal for speed.

  5. 5Collect the output

    The station stacks the ore up to 9,999, ready to grab whenever you need it.

Coralum Ore and Chromite, made easy#

The point of the station is skipping the two ore grinds that eat the most time. Coralum Ore forms in the deep sea and normally has to be fished out of supply drops. Chromite is buried underground and normally has to be tracked down island by island with a Metal Detector. The synthesizer replaces both with a recipe you queue once.

OreOld farming methodWith the Synthesizer
Coralum OreFish deep-sea supply drops with a magnet and rodQueue the recipe, collect from the station
ChromiteMetal-detect certain islands by handQueue the recipe, collect from the station

Because the same station also makes ingots, stone, and other ores, one build covers most of your gathering needs. Swap the recipe whenever your priorities change and the assigned Pal picks up the new order immediately.

Is it worth building?#

If you are past level 78 and tired of chasing Coralum Ore supply drops or hunting Chromite with a detector, the Ancient Material Synthesizer is the clear upgrade. The build cost is steep, but it is a one-time investment that turns two of the game's worst grinds into a hands-off production line.
